The ratio of water to flowers is 24(water) to 30(flowers).
This can be expressed 24/30
You need to find the equivalent ratio of x (water) to 45 (flowers)
so, write an equation that states the two ratios are the same:
24 / 30 = x / 45
Multiply both sides of this equation by 45 in order to solve for x.
45 ( 24/30) = x
Note this can easily be done without a calculator by REDUCING: 45 and 30 have a common factor of 15. So, dividing each by 15 gives you
3 (24/2) = x
36 = x
36 liters of water to for 45 flowers.
